Orangeburg, Calhoun County, South Carolina Property Taxes
Median Orangeburg, SC effective property tax rate: 0.60%, significantly lower than the national median of 1.02%, but lower than the SC state median of 0.72%.
Median Orangeburg, SC home value: $40,950
Median annual Orangeburg, SC tax bill: $244, $2,156 lower than the national median property tax bill of $2,400.

Property Tax Rates Across Orangeburg, Calhoun County, South Carolina
Local government entities are responsible for setting tax rates, and these can vary significantly within a state. This variation arises because each county annually estimates its budgetary needs to provide essential services and then divides this by the total assessed value of all taxable property within its boundaries. This calculation determines the property tax rate. While the process involves votes and legal regulations, this is the fundamental method by which property tax rates are established each year.
In Orangeburg, in Calhoun County, South Carolina, the effective property tax rate is notably lower than both the state and national medians. This can be advantageous for property owners, as it means a lower tax burden relative to other areas. Property Tax Assessment Values Across Orangeburg, Calhoun County, South Carolina
When examining property taxes in Orangeburg, South Carolina, understanding the distinction between "market value" and "assessed value" is crucial. The market value is what a willing buyer would pay to a willing seller in an open and competitive market, often influenced by location, property condition, and economic market trends. The Calhoun County appraisal district estimates the market value for tax purposes. The assessed value is the market value minus any applicable exemptions or limits determined by local laws and offerings. The tax assessed value is the figure used to calculate your property taxes or the amount multiplied by your tax rate to get your tax bill.
In Calhoun County, assessment notices are sent in the spring each year. They’ll typically reach your mailbox by the middle of April. Each property owner receives an assessment notice that contains both the market value and assessed value, along with an estimate of your property tax bill. Property Tax Bills Across Orangeburg, Calhoun County, South Carolina
In Orangeburg, located in Calhoun County, SC, property tax bills are calculated based on the assessed value of a home, which is derived from its market value. The local tax rate is applied to this assessed value to determine the annual tax bill. Homeowners in Orangeburg typically face a median tax bill of $244, which is significantly lower than the national median property tax bill of $2,400. Factors influencing the tax bill include the property's location, market conditions, and any applicable exemptions or deductions. Homeowners may find their tax bills falling within the 25th percentile at $121 or reaching the 90th percentile at $981.
